Peter Marsh Chase

Grade – Premier Handicap
Course – Haydock
Race Type – Handicap Chase
Distance – 3 Miles 1 Furlong (25F)
Ages – 5yo’s +
Weights – Handicap

Recent Form and Trends

* The 2013 & 2023 races were abandoned due to frost/snow

Trends

Age – 9 of the last 10 winners were aged 7 or older
Price – 3 of the last 10 winners were favourites/joint favourites, 5/10 winners were in the top 3 in the betting
Last Run – 3 of the last 10 winners won on their last run before the Peter Marsh Chase, 8/10 winners ran within the last 36 days
Previous Course Form – 9/10 winners had at least 1 previous run at Haydock, 7/10 winners had at least 1 previous win at Haydock
Previous Distance Form – 8/10 winners had at least 6 previous runs over 22-25 furlongs, 7/10 had at least 1 previous win over 22-25 furlongs
Previous Chase Form – 8/10 winners had at least 8 previous chase runs, 8/10 winners had at least 2 previous chase wins, 5/10 winners had at least 3 previous chase wins
Rating – 10/10 winners were rated 135 or higher
Graded Wins – 5/10 winners had at least 1 previous win in a grade 1-3 race
Season Form – 9/10 winners had at least 2 runs that season, 4/10 winners had at least 1 win that season

Future Form

Trends

Next Run
0 of the last 10 winners won on their next run after the Peter Marsh Chase, 3/10 placed on their next run
5/10 winners ran in the Grand National Trial (Haydock) on their next run, 0 of the 5 won, 1 placed

Rest of The Season Runs
7 of the last 10 winners ran in at least 2 more races that season
0/10 won at least 1 more race that season, 3/10 placed in at least 1 more race that season

Grand National Run That Season
2/10 winners ran in the Aintree Grand National that season, 0 of the 2 won, 0 placed
